Schedule a tour View the weekly newsletter



Our culture is loving, nurturing and supportive of our students and families.

We foster a warm and nurturing environment and use supportive, encouraging language and positive reinforcement.


We recognize it takes a community-minded environment to make a difference in each child's life.

Working as a team with a student’s family, we maintain an approachable and accessible relationship with students and parents.


Beyond academics, we maximize each student's potential-emotionally, socially, physically and spiritually.

We support students so they experience success in the classroom and grow confident in their abilities. We assist students in navigating socially, and encourage our students to be healthy in mind, body and spirit.


We honor each student's individualized learning style.

We utilize differentiated instruction in order to maximize each student’s potential. We provide flexibility within program offerings including the arts, athletics, music, technology, and foreign language, just to name a few.


We teach children how to think, not what to think.

We are a model school for critical thinking, and our teachers are highly trained to teach specific thinking skills. We infuse our curriculum with precise critical thinking strategies and habits-of-mind in order to produce skillful problem solvers and decision makers.

Recent News

Top STEAM Toys of 2015 March 05, 2015

Children learn through play. They master everything from talking to eye-hand coordination to relationships through the games … » read more

View all news

Classrooms & Homework

Select your classroom for easy access to class information & homework assignments.

School Calendars